Today in 2001, the actor Steve Buscemi returned to his old fire house in Manhattan's Little Italy, Engine 55. Put on a spare uniform and went to work.
Buscemi trained as a fire fighter in 1980 and worked in the FNDY until left to pursue acting in 1984.
He worked for several days in the rubble of the towers, working 12 hour shifts and refused interviews with the press. He has only now began to open up about happened that day and that he is suffering with a form of PTSD from what he saw in the wreckage. Prior to this all he ever said on the matter was that he and his then wife provided pizza, drinks and support to the other crew’s families.
In 2014 he was appointed an Honorary Battalion Chief of the FDNY.
